## Configuration

We finally retired the hand-rolled queue (RIP `jobrunner.sh`, you served Bramblewick well). Everything now goes through Ferrytide, which is pickier about config but way less haunted. Future maintainers: the worker pool sizes live in `ferrytide.toml`, and most defaults are fine. The one thing Ferrytide absolutely requires at startup is its broker credential, set in the env file on the line right after this:

sealed setting: ARCHIVE_KEY3=8d0

## Runbook: Emberpoints ledger reconciliation

Plugin authors: if accrual events appear out of order, do not retry writes manually — the Emberpoints ledger deduplicates on idempotency window boundaries, and premature retries can double-credit. First confirm your integration matches the ledger's live settings, especially the window and batch limits. Those settings are reproduced below.

deployment values, yadug-bawif:
[framir]
team = pelox
access_code = ac_a38ab2
owner = tamion.julael
host = framir.tolvaqlabs.test
port = 11211
peer = tammir.zemvargrid.local
salt = 2215ef03
pin = 1541

- [ ] **Step 7: Breaker override escrow.** After sealing the signing keys for the Tallgrove upstream API circuit breaker, confirm the support team can force the breaker open during a full outage. The override bundle lives in the sealed escrow drawer and is useless without its unlock phrase. Two ceremony witnesses must initial this step before proceeding. The escrow bundle is decrypted with the recovery passphrase that follows.

vault phrase of kahip-kahop = holath-quenmir

Quick note on the evening cleaners from Brightmoor Services: they're cleared for Levels 1–3 only, and someone from the facilities desk should let them in rather than leaving the service door propped. If nobody's around when they arrive, they can let themselves in — the service-door code is below.

door code, yagap-bahof: bdg-O-05